These MOT failure patterns show up more often on this registration year than on similar cars of the same class, age, and mileage.
Shares below are measured across the 1,590 failed first attempts in 2025 that the age-and-mileage comparison can be computed on.
Standout: Leaf spring (rear) — 6.9% of this year's failed first attempts
Recorded on 109 of those tests. It tops the table on elevation — about 23× more often than on similar cars of the same age and mileage. That is what makes it unusual for its class, which is a different question from what is most likely to fail; the buying checklist ranks by that. The full ranked list is in the table below.
